What is PULT?

The fund invests in a diversified short duration portfolio of fixed-income securities comprised of investment-grade money market and other fixed-income securities, including U. dollar-denominated foreign securities of these types, with a focus on companies or issuers that Putnam Management, the fund"s investment manager, believes meet relevant environmental, social or governance ("ESG") criteria on a sector-specific basis ("ESG criteria").
